What makes a medical billing transition work for a Covina healthcare office?

Useful reporting should make unresolved work visible. Practices should be able to review claim status, rejection and denial causes, accounts-receivable aging, payment activity and issues requiring staff attention. The appropriate detail depends on the service scope, but reports should help the Covina practice decide what to address next rather than merely summarize past transactions.
